How much do remote hunting camp cook j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 18,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ote hunting camp cook in the United States is $19.41,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.87 and $23.80 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some unique challenges faced by a Remote Hunting Camp Cook, and how can I prepare for them?

As a Remote Hunting Camp Cook, you'll often work in isolated locations with limited access to supplies and equipment. Common challenges include planning menus with non-perishable ingredients, adapting to unpredictable weather, and ensuring food safety without modern conveniences. It's important to be resourceful, flexible, and skilled in outdoor cooking techniques. Preparing by learning about food preservation, campfire safety, and improvising with minimal kitchen tools will help you succeed in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Hunting Camp Cook,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Hunting Camp Cook, you need strong culinary skills, knowledge of safe food handling, and experience planning menus with limited resources, often supported by a food safety certification. Familiarity with camp stoves, portable grills, and wilderness cooking equipment is essential. Adaptability, resourcefulness, and excellent organization are vital soft skills for managing unpredictable conditions and meeting the needs of camp guests. These skills ensure nutritious, safe, and satisfying meals in challenging environments, contributing to the overall success and morale of the camp.

What are remote hunting camp cooks?

Remote hunting camp cooks are culinary professionals responsible for preparing meals in isolated or wilderness hunting camps. They often work in rustic conditions, using limited kitchen facilities to provide nutritious and hearty meals for hunters and camp staff. Their duties include meal planning, food safety, managing supplies, and sometimes accommodating special dietary needs. These cooks play a vital role in ensuring the comfort and well-being of everyone at the camp, often working independently and adapting to challenging environments.

ย Working Conditions and Physical Requirements

Weather: Indoor/Outdoor.ย  Frequently exposed to arctic conditions.ย 

Noise level:ย  Moderate to Loud

Description of environment: This is an industrial kitchen setting located in a remote camp.

Must constantly be able to stand, walk, climb, push, pull use hands and arms, stoop, kneel and crouch.ย 

Travel:ย  Must be able to travel by plane and/or bus to remote camps.ย 

Physical requirements: Fit For Duty Test

  • Lift:ย  Lift 50 lbs. from floor to knuckle x 2
  • Lift:ย  Lift 50 lbs. from floor to waist x 2
  • Lift:ย  Lift 50 lbs. from floor to shoulders x 2
  • Lift:ย  Lift 30 lbs. from floor to crown x 2
  • Carry:ย  Carry 20 lbs. with two hands for a minimum distance of 20 feet
  • Push:ย  Push horizontally with a peak force of 50 f-lbs. with two hands.
  • Stoop & Twist:ย  Perform alternate cross over toe touches x 5 each side, self-paced, continuous.
  • Squat Test:ย  Functionally squat x 5, self-paced but continuous.
  • Kneel:ย  Kneel on one knee and stand. Return to kneel on opposite knee.ย  Repeat alternate kneeling sequence x 5 for each knee, self-paced but continuous.
  • Stairs:ย  Climb up and down 10 steps x 4 for a total of 40 steps, self-paced but continuous
  • Stairs & Carry:ย  Climb up and down 10 steps x 2 for a total of 20 steps while carrying 30 lbs. in one hand and using the other hand to grasp a railing for safety, self-paced.
    • Allow a 30 second rest period after climbing up and down 10 steps while carrying.
